Happy #LearningWednesday! Today, let's review the excellent work "AI-driven 3D Spatial Transcriptomics.” Where VORTEX is presented: an AI framework that predicts 3D transcriptomic profiles from minimal 2D data: https://t.co/3Gmd6wfrln

Happy #LearningWednesday! Today, let's review this paper https://t.co/ERIcU0mzTq describing how Skin-iDISCO+ enables 3D vascular imaging, efficient decolorization, and minimal tissue deformation, overcoming 2D limitations. https://t.co/9wGF9mY0Mf

Happy #LearningWednesday! Let's review the paper: “INSIHGT: an accessible multi-scale, multimodal 3D spatial biology platform.” INSIHGT enables deep, 3D staining, bridging histology and pathology for research and clinical use. https://t.co/Mj2qKYeplN https://t.co/26x7VWUyu0

Welcome to this #LearningWednesday! This month, Nature Methods features an entire section on 3D histology! Emphasizing the importance of analyzing tissues in their full 3D context. Today, let’s dive into the editorial for this special session: https://t.co/CHWm0iFqI9

Happy #LearningWednesday! We present a recent study titled "Innervation of nociceptor neurons in the spleen promotes germinal center responses and humoral immunity." Get ready to be delighted by stunning images of the 3D structure of nociceptive neurons: https://t.co/8Loe1jzOXr

Happy #LearningWednesday! “Multiplexed 3D Analysis of Immune States and Niches in Human Tissue”. A high-res 3D imaging approach that reveals detailed cell interactions and structures in tissue, offering insights into melanoma beyond traditional 2D imaging. https://t.co/CC3OssUHo5

Happy #LearningWednesday! Let's review the Cell paper from Andrew Song & Prof Mahmood's lab https://t.co/UPJI1VKFz8! Showing how 3D analysis surpasses 2D, presenting Tripath,a novel method for non-destructively analyzing 3D pathology samples with the help of weakly supervised AI

Happy #LearningWednesday! This paper describes a new tool for 3D imaging of PD-L1 in triple-negative breast cancer that revealed spatial variations missed by traditional 2D methods, promising improved patient selection for immunotherapy. https://t.co/2A0PVxJRq4

Happy #LearningWednesday! Let's delve into how advanced non-destructive 3D imaging technologies reveal tumor heterogeneity and assess PD-L1 expression in non-small cell lung cancer, uncovering depth-level variations missed in traditional imaging methods. https://t.co/NLn50Qga4v
